Ang Firefox 110 ay inilabas. Ang isang pangmatagalang update sa sangay ng suporta, 102.8.0, ay inilabas din. Ang Firefox 111, na naka-iskedyul para sa paglabas sa Marso 14, ay malapit nang pumasok sa beta testing.
Mga pangunahing inobasyon sa Firefox 110:
- Idinagdag ang kakayahang mag-import ng mga bookmark, kasaysayan ng pagba-browse, at mga password mula sa mga browser ng Opera, Opera GX, at Vivaldi (noon, ang katulad na pag-import ay suportado para sa Edge, Chrome, at Safari).

- Sa mga platform Linux и macOS Mayroon nang suporta para sa GPU upang mapabilis ang rasterization ng Canvas2D.
- Sa mga platform Linux, Windows и macOS Pinahusay ang pagganap ng WebGL.
- Ang kakayahang mag-clear ng mga field na may mga petsa at oras (petsa, oras, petsa-lokal na mga uri sa elemento) ay ibinibigay ) sa pamamagitan ng pagpindot sa Cmd+Backspace at Cmd+Delete macOS at Ctrl+Backspace sa loob Linux и Windows.
- Ang built-in na Colorways add-on, na nag-aalok ng koleksyon ng mga tema ng kulay para sa pagbabago ng hitsura ng lugar ng nilalaman, mga panel, at tab bar, ay hindi na ipinagpatuloy. Maaari mong i-restore ang add-on at i-restore ang iyong mga naka-save na setting sa pamamagitan ng pag-install ng Colorways add-on mula sa addons.mozilla.org.
- Sa platform Windows Pinagana ang sandbox isolation ng mga prosesong nakikipag-ugnayan sa GPU.
- В Windows 10/11 Pinapagana ang hardware video decoding sa mga non-Intel GPU, na nagpapabuti sa performance ng video playback at kalidad ng pag-scale.
- Sa platform Windows Naipatupad na ang suporta para sa pagharang sa mga third-party plugin na mai-embed sa Firefox. Halimbawa, maaaring i-install ng mga antivirus package at archiver ang mga external plugin, na nagdudulot ng mga pag-crash, mga isyu sa pag-uugali, mga problema sa compatibility, at pagbaba ng performance, na iniuugnay ng mga user sa sariling kawalang-tatag ng Firefox. Available ang pahinang "about:third-party" para sa pamamahala ng mga external plugin.
- Nagtatampok ang built-in na PDF viewer ng maayos na pag-scale.
- Ang CSS query na "@container", na nagpapahintulot sa iyo na mag-istilo ng mga elemento depende sa laki ng parent na elemento (katulad ng query na "@media", hindi inilapat sa laki ng buong nakikitang lugar, ngunit sa laki ng bloke (container) kung saan nakalagay ang elemento), ngayon ay sumusuporta sa mga sumusunod na unit ng pagsukat: cqw (1% ng lapad), cqh (1%), sa cqh (1%). (1% ng laki ng block), cqmin (ang pinakamaliit na halaga ng cqi o cqb) at cqmax (ang pinakamalaking halaga ng cqi o cqb).
- Sinusuportahan na ngayon ng CSS ang mga pinangalanang pahina, na tinukoy sa pamamagitan ng property na "pahina". Binibigyang-daan ka ng property na ito na tukuyin ang uri ng page kung saan maaaring ipakita ang isang elemento. Binibigyang-daan ka ng feature na ito na tukuyin ang disenyong tukoy sa pahina at deklaratibong magdagdag ng mga page break para sa pag-print.
- Idinagdag ang color-gamut media query sa CSS upang maglapat ng mga istilo batay sa tinatayang hanay ng color palette na sinusuportahan ng browser at output device.
- Sa elemento Nagdagdag ng suporta para sa attribute na "list" para ipakita ang interface ng pagpili ng kulay mula sa listahan.
- Nagdagdag ng suporta para sa flag na "midi" sa Mga Pahintulot ng API upang tingnan ang pahintulot na ma-access ang Web MIDI API.
- Sinusuportahan na ngayon ng ReadableStream API ang "para sa paghihintay...ng" syntax para sa asynchronous na pag-ulit sa pamamagitan ng mga bloke sa isang stream.
- Mga pagpapabuti sa bersyon para sa Android: Sa mga device na may Android Nagdagdag ang 13+ ng suporta para sa mga icon ng app na naka-link sa tema o kulay ng background. Pinahusay ang pagpili ng tekstong may maraming linya.
Bilang karagdagan sa mga inobasyon at pag-aayos ng bug, ang Firefox 109 ay nag-ayos ng 25 mga kahinaan. 16 na mga kahinaan ay minarkahan bilang mapanganib, kung saan 8 na mga kahinaan (nakolekta sa ilalim ng CVE-2023-25745 at CVE-2023-25744) ay sanhi ng mga problema sa memorya, tulad ng mga buffer overflow at pag-access sa mga nabakanteng lugar ng memorya. Posible, ang mga problemang ito ay maaaring humantong sa pagpapatupad ng code ng isang umaatake kapag binubuksan ang mga espesyal na idinisenyong pahina.
Pinagmulan: opennet.ru

